70lb terrier terrified of vet exams/grooming: alternatives to heavy sedation?

Hi all! Looking for advice on my dog Gal.

Backstory: rescued her at 3 weeks old (mom rejected her). No known trauma, and at home with her 3 housemates she's happy, goofy, and affectionate. We adore her.

She loves car rides (and barking at everything she sees), and she's actually excited to go to the vet; she wants to be everyone's friend. Problem is, since she missed out on litter socialization, she never learned bite inhibition/how to say "no" politely; she goes straight to nipping or biting. (My fault, training-wise; she was my first dog and I didn't know better.)

The actual issue: she panics during vet exams and grooming. We're in Mexico, and our vet won't touch her without acepromazine (a central nervous system depressant) first. I don't love that, and even sedated she's not calm enough to be groomed.

Question: How do I get a 70lb terrier groomed/examined without heavily tranquilizing her every time?
